A Prospective, Two-cohort Phase II Trial of Standard Systemic Therapy in Combination With High/Low-dose Radiotherapy Plus Toripalimab for Metastatic Colorectal Cancer
Phase 2 trial testing standard systemic therapy combined with high/low-dose radiotherapy plus toripalimab in Microsatellite Stable Metastatic Colorectal Cancer in 96 participants. Currently enrolling.

Who can join
Adults 18 to 75, any sex, with Microsatellite Stable Metastatic Colorectal Cancer.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.
What's being measured
Primary outcomes are the specific endpoints the trial is designed to prove or disprove.
-
PFS
Time frame: Up to 2 years
Defined as the time from initiation of treatment to PD or death from any cause.
Sponsor's own description
TORCH-M is a prospective, single-arm, two-cohort, investigator-initiated phase II trial to investigate the efficacy and safety of standard systemic therapy in combination with high/low-dose radiotherapy plus toripalimab in paitents with microsatellite stable metastatic colorectal cancer (MSS mCRC). Eligible patients will be assigned to two cohorts according to previous treatment: a first-line cohort A and a second-line cohort B. Patients in both arms will first receive one cycle of standard systemic therapy and toripalimab, followed by high/low-dose radiotherapy, and then continue with standard systemic therapy and toripalimab.The survival benefits, response rates, and adverse effects will be analyzed.
